Affiliate Marketing For Starters: The Basics Can Make You Money

Using affiliate ads and creating websites that draw a large audience can make you a great deal of money. This article is full of tips on affiliate marketing for starter and advice on how to help your affiliate marketing website grow and thrive.

When evaluating different affiliate marketing opportunities, ask what process they use to monitor and fulfill orders placed from locations outside their own website. If the company is not careful with their tracking, especially on phone orders, you may lose commission.

Using Facebook For Business - Proven Strategies To Try!

For a lot of folks, Facebook is somewhere to waste their time. But, it really can be an amazingly useful tool in terms of marketing. Countless individuals utilize Facebook, and reaching them can produce tremendous results. Read on to learn some tips when using facebook for business.

You can quickly expand your viewers on Facebook by holding a competition. Provide discounts and prizes to those who give your page a "like." Be sure that you do give people the prize or you may end up losing a few customers for not being honest.

Using Facebook For Business

  1. When you market your business on Facebook, post professionally. While there is a generally relaxed atmosphere on Facebook, you still want your business to come across as competent and professional. When you use a professional tone on Facebook, people will trust you and your company.
  2. When using Facebook to market your product or service, you have to be sure your page sticks out from other similar pages. You should add pictures and colors to attract attention. Facebook users usually respond better to these pages compared to plain ones.
  3. You don't necessarily need a page, a group may be better for you. The group can lead to a community on Facebook, where your customers can exchange comments and ideas. Both pages and groups will allow your followers to see what you are doing and then they can respond in kind.
  4. Don't forget the people that are already subscribed to your page. There are people that just want likes and then they forget about existing fans. You should ensure that your audience feels appreciated. This engages your consumers with your brand, so you can't forget who your champions are.
  5. Know when it's okay to post something about your business when you're not on your personal Facebook page. Posting your opinion on Facebook profiles that you don't run can get your page some attention. Make sure you're seeking the right kind of attention. Only make posts on other pages if you have something worth saying. You don't ever want to be guilty of spamming.
  6. If you have a company like a car business, you might not want a specific Facebook page but instead use targeted Facebook ads. Your customers often come and go at random and will not be following posts. As an alternative, consider advertising on Facebook instead.
